USB flash drives are indispensable tools for storing and transferring data, but they are highly susceptible to corruption, write-protection errors, and sudden hardware recognition failures. When standard formatting tools built into Windows or macOS fail, production-level utility software becomes necessary. For mass storage devices built on Firstchip controllers, the (Mass Production Tool) is the definitive industry-standard software used to revive dead drives, flash firmware, and restore factory performance.
